What is a contract CISSP professional?

A Contract CISSP Professional is a cybersecurity expert who holds the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P) certification and works on a contractual basis rather than as a full-time employee. These professionals are hired by organizations for specific projects or periods to help design, implement, and manage security protocols to protect sensitive information. Their responsibilities often include risk assessment, security policy development, and ensuring compliance with security standards. Hiring a contract CISSP provides organizations with specialized expertise without the long-term commitment of a permanent hire.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a contract CISSP professional?

To thrive as a Contract CISSP Professional, you need in-depth knowledge of information security principles, risk management, and compliance frameworks, supported by a CISSP certification and relevant IT security experience. Familiarity with security tools such as SIEM platforms, vulnerability scanners, and network monitoring systems is typically required. Strong analytical thinking, effective communication, and adaptability are vital soft skills for collaborating with diverse teams and responding to evolving threats. These competencies are crucial for safeguarding organizational assets, ensuring regulatory compliance, and delivering effective contract-based security solutions.

What are some common challenges faced by contract CISSP professionals when integrating with new client teams?

Contract CISSP Professionals often face challenges such as quickly adapting to new organizational cultures and understanding unique security policies and infrastructures. Since projects are typically short-term, building trust with in-house teams and stakeholders in a limited timeframe can be demanding. Additionally, contractors must rapidly assess existing security controls, identify vulnerabilities, and recommend improvements while ensuring seamless collaboration with both IT and non-technical staff. Effective communication and adaptability are key to overcoming these challenges.

What is the difference between Contract Cissp Professional vs Network Security Analyst?

AspectContract Cissp ProfessionalNetwork Security Analyst
CertificationsCISSP required or preferredTypically CISSP, Security+, or equivalent
Work EnvironmentContract-based, project-specific, often consultingFull-time, in-house or security team
Industry UsageUsed across various industries for security consultingPrimarily in IT and cybersecurity departments

The Contract Cissp Professional and Network Security Analyst roles both focus on cybersecurity, often requiring CISSP certification. However, Contract Cissp Professionals usually work on short-term projects or consulting engagements, while Network Security Analysts are typically employed full-time within organizations to monitor and protect networks.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right career path or job opportunity.

What is the salary of a Contract CISSP Professional?

A Contract CISSP Professional typically earns between $80,000 and $150,000 annually, depending on experience, location, and project scope. Contract roles often pay higher hourly rates compared to full-time positions, reflecting the specialized cybersecurity skills and certifications required.
